**Telemetry Compression — Overview**

Devices in the Graywell fleet ship telemetry every 30 seconds. The Packrat encoder delta-compresses numeric fields, then applies dictionary compression per batch. Larger windows compress better but risk data loss on device reboot, so we cap buffer size aggressively. Thresholds were chosen from the Marlow load tests last quarter. The encoder reads the following constants at startup.

tuning table, kajog-kawef:
PRIORITIES = {
    "kelox": 870,
    "kasix": 89,
    "eliax": 988,
}

**Mgmt Meeting Minutes — Retiring the Brightline Range**

Quick recap for sales leads at Fenholt Supplies: we agreed to retire the Brightline fixture range by year-end. Remaining stock moves to clearance pricing next month, and accounts on standing orders get migrated to the Lumetta range. Trade-in incentives were approved in principle. The confidential note on next steps sits just below.

board note of bajof-bajeg: The pricing group signed off on a budget of $13.4 million for Project Sildor. The renewal with Lamixek Holdings closes at $48.9 million a year, 49 percent above the last contract.

## Session Handling — Incremental Rebuilds (Fernwheel SSG)

Rebuild workers reuse one session per content batch. Sessions expire after 15 minutes idle; the scheduler refreshes them before dispatch. Reviewers: check that partial rebuilds never share sessions across tenants. To trigger a manual incremental rebuild against staging, call the rebuild endpoint with the token below.

session JWT of yawep-yawep = eyJhbGciOiJIUzI1NiIsInR5cCI6IkpXVCJ9.eyJzdWIiOiI3pWF3_In0.aXYsHiog

- [ ] Step 7: Archive cold storage buckets (Glacierline tier). Confirm both ceremony witnesses are present, verify bucket manifests match the Oxbow ledger, then seal the archive key shares. Plugin authors may observe but not handle shares. Once sealed, the archive index itself is encrypted and can only be reopened with the passphrase below.

vault phrase of badup-hahig = tamael-aldael-kelmir-istael-fenok-istwyn-tamius-jorath-oliion